NUPENG begins 3-day warning strike, Wednesday
NIGERIA Union of Petroleum and Natural Gas Workers, NUPENG, is set to begin a three-day nationwide warning strike on Wednesday, over disputes with International Oil Companies, IOCs, especially indiscriminate sack of workers without benefits and refusal to allow their workers to join union.
Don’t resume bombing of oil installations, Aginighan, Mulade beg Avengers
Former Acting Managing Director, Niger Delta Development Commission, NDDC, Pastor Power Aginighan and Niger Delta activist, Sheriff Mulade, yesterday, appealed to the Niger Delta Avenger, NDA, and other militant groups in the region not to resume bombing of oil installations to give the Federal Government the needed opportunity to take a holistic approach towards the development of the Niger Delta region.
Zaha helps Elephants win on his debut
Crystal Palace winger Wilfried Zaha provided the decisive cross on his Ivory Coast debut as the African champions beat Sweden 2-1 in an Africa Cup of Nations warm-up match lastnight.
